Program DirectorTalcott Financial Group is an international life insurance group and the industry's trusted partner for comprehensive risk solutions. Talcott creatively designs and expertly delivers responsive solutions that transfer risk and manage capital in a way that supports the strategic needs of insurers today and into the future.Talcott Financial Group has a proven track record of well-executed transactions, and the enterprise benefits from its strong financial position with over $130 billion in assets under management, its investment-grade financial strength ratings, and its partnership with Sixth Street, a leading global investment firm.Talcott Financial Group's two core business platforms include: U.S. based Talcott Resolution and Bermuda and Cayman based Talcott Re.The Program Director will join Talcott's Portfolio Management Organization (PMO), taking ownership of delivering high-impact, enterprise-wide programs within established timelines and budgets across business groups. This senior leader will foster a culture rooted in accountability, agility, and measurable results, while championing modern delivery practices including AI-enabled tools and approaches to accelerate outcomes. The ideal candidate brings domain expertise in life and annuity products and reinsurance transactions, exceptional business and financial acumen, and a proven record of successful delivery across diverse regions and business units. This role demands very strong, decisive leadership, strategic influence, and outstanding communication and collaboration skills. Success in matrixed environments and expertise in project methodologies, governance, and business alignment are essential. We are seeking an execution-focused leader to guide governance and drive delivery for complex, transformational initiatives that support Talcott's growth. This position will follow a hybrid work arrangement schedule and can be based out of one of our Talcott offices in Hartford, CT., Charlotte, N.C. or New York, N.Y.Responsibilities:Plan, organize, and control activities across programs of varying complexity, ensuring delivery within defined scope, timeline, and budgetDevelop and maintain comprehensive program plans; track key milestones, dependencies, and phase reviews across the lifecyclePartner across functions to build robust business cases, manage program budgets, and connect delivery outcomes to financial results and value realizationDrive process reengineering to simplify, standardize, and optimize workflows championing opportunities to apply automation and AI that accelerate deliveryCollaborate with program sponsors and senior stakeholders to align goals with strategic objectives and define success metrics and business casesProactively identify and manage program risks, issues, and changesMaintain a focus on regulatory, actuarial, and financial complexity inherent in insurance and reinsurance programsLead Steering Committee meetings and drive effective senior leadership decision-makingOversee program budgets, resource allocation, stakeholder communication, and executive reporting.Support change management, user adoption, and operational readinessInfluence cross-functional teams and vendors to drive accountability and program outcomes, using strong negotiation and conflict-management skills to resolve competing priorities and drive alignment.Champion a culture of continuous improvement by regularly evaluating program management processes, tools, and methodologies to identify opportunities for increased efficiency, effectiveness, and quality.Promote knowledge sharing and cross-team collaboration to leverage collective expertise and accelerate problem-solvingEncourage a mindset of agility and adaptability, enabling teams to respond effectively to changing business needs and program requirements.Build strong, effective business relationships that contribute to driving our strategic priorities.Qualifications:Bachelor's degree in business, finance, economics, or a related field; advanced degree a plus.Minimum of 15 years of program leadership in the Insurance and/or Financial Services domain, with direct experience in life and annuity products and/or reinsurance (e.g., block acquisitions, treaty reinsurance, closed-block or in-force management, policy administration)Strong finance orientation, with the ability to partner with Finance and Actuarial teamsCapacity to interpret business cases and financial models with multi-year program budgetsDemonstrated familiarity with AI, automation, and data-driven deliveryReadily able to apply emerging technologies for the improvement of business initiativesFamiliarity with process reengineering and workflow optimization, with a track record of delivering pragmatic, scalable improvements.Deep knowledge of project portfolio management, program governance, risk management and change enablement.Proven leadership with mentorship that cultivates project management best practices with junior talentDemonstrated ability to lead, influence and inspire high-performing teamsExperience driving decisions at the executive level within a matrixed organizationExceptional inter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skillsStrong facilitation, negotiation, and conflict-management abilitiesAptitude to influence and drive alignment at all levels of the organizationCertifications in PMP, PgMP, and Agile strongly preferred (e.g., PMI-ACP, SAFe, CSM).Key Competencies:Executive Presence & Strategic InfluenceDecisive, Inspirational LeadershipBusiness & Financial AcumenLife, Annuity & Reinsurance Domain ExpertiseStrong AI fluency and applicationProcess Reengineering & AutomationNegotiation & Conflict ManagementAgility in Complex, Evolving EnvironmentsStakeholder Management & InfluenceAnalytical Thinking & Decision-MakingCross-functional CollaborationCompensation:This range represents the minimum and maximum annual base salary we reasonably expect to pay for this role at the time of posting.
